// Download service configuration.
//
// Loaded based on experiment parameters from the server. Use default values if
// no server configuration was detected.
struct Configuration {
 public:
  // Create the configuration.
  static std::unique_ptr<Configuration> CreateFromFinch();
  Configuration();

  // An interval to throttle battery status queries.
  base::TimeDelta battery_query_interval;

  // Minimum battery percentage to start the background task or start the
  // download when battery requirement is sensitive.
  int download_battery_percentage;

  // The maximum number of downloads the DownloadService can have currently in
  // Active or Paused states.
  uint32_t max_concurrent_downloads;

  // The maximum number of downloads the DownloadService can have currently in
  // only Active state.
  uint32_t max_running_downloads;

  // The maximum number of downloads that are scheduled for each client using
  // the download service.
  uint32_t max_scheduled_downloads;

  // The maximum number of retries before the download is aborted.
  uint32_t max_retry_count;

  // The maximum number of conceptually 'free' resumptions before the download
  // is aborted.  This is a failsafe to prevent constantly hammering the source.
  uint32_t max_resumption_count;

  // The time that the download service will keep the files around before
  // deleting them if the client hasn't handle the files.
  base::TimeDelta file_keep_alive_time;

  // The maximum time that the download service can keep the files around before
  // forcefully deleting them even if the client doesn't agree.
  base::TimeDelta max_file_keep_alive_time;

  // The length of the flexible time window during which the scheduler must
  // schedule a file cleanup task.
  base::TimeDelta file_cleanup_window;

  // The start window time in seconds for OS to schedule background task.
  // The OS will trigger the background task in this window.
  base::TimeDelta window_start_time;

  // The end window time in seconds for OS to schedule background task.
  // The OS will trigger the background task in this window.
  base::TimeDelta window_end_time;

  // The delay to initialize internal components to wait for network stack
  // ready.
  base::TimeDelta network_startup_delay;

  // The delay to notify network status changes.
  base::TimeDelta network_change_delay;

  // The delay to notify about the navigation completion.
  base::TimeDelta navigation_completion_delay;

  // The timeout to wait for after a navigation starts.
  base::TimeDelta navigation_timeout_delay;

  // The minimum timeout after which upload entries waiting on data from their
  // clients might be killed.
  base::TimeDelta pending_upload_timeout_delay;

  // The delay to retry a download when the download is failed.
  base::TimeDelta download_retry_delay;

 private:
  DISALLOW_COPY_AND_ASSIGN(Configuration);
};
